What is Hot Stone Massage?

 Hot Stone Massage is an incredibly relaxing therapy that uses flat, heated volcanic stones to release tension from the body by easing tense muscles, stiff joints and damaged soft tissues.

A variety of different shapes and sizes of stones are used, prior to, during and after the treatment the therapist will use the appropriate shaped stone depending on the areas of the body that are being treated . As a guide the smallest stones are placed between the toes prior to treatment to warm the feet which allows the body to relax. During the treatment medium shaped stones which are flat and round in shape are held in the therapist's hands whilst the body is massaged using a variety of effleurage and petrissage massage techniques.
For areas of excessive tension that are difficult to access fully with the round stones specially shaped pointed stones are used to work into the trigger points for example into the shoulder blades and specific points on the neck.
For larger parts of the body such as the back the largest stones which are also flat and round in shape may be used to massage with but are most often used for placement allowing the heat to penetrate even deeper into the client's muscles.
By incorporating warm volcanic stones into the massage directly onto the skin relaxation can be felt at the deepest level which promotes a meditative state of harmony. A balanced flow of energy throughout the body following the treatment will leave you feeling grounded and completely relaxed.
